IKEv2 uses an initial handshake in which VPN peers negotiate cryptographic algorithms, mutually
authenticate, and establish a session key, creating an IKE-SA. Additionally, a first IPsec SA is
established during the initial SA creation. All IKEv2 messages are request/response pairs. It is the
responsibility of the side sending the request to retransmit if it does not receive a timely response.

shutdown
crypto-remote-vpn-client commands
Disables remote-vpn-client on this profile or device. Remote VPN client feature is disabled by
default.
To enable remote VPN client, use the no > shutdown command.
